Output 49400325efb56030b788d04c2eca5ea1bc3188289a3c852fcac8a978865ef786:1

value
24050109
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de83b4e4271507b4c47bf6ba3cc9ea00dec9b9cabd7ac278b6e12dda7ff0d7f6
address
tb1pm6pmfep8z5rmf3rm76arej02qr0vnww2h4avy79kuyka5lls6lmqlxlxvx
transaction
49400325efb56030b788d04c2eca5ea1bc3188289a3c852fcac8a978865ef786
confirmations
38157
spent
true